At least 167 serious crimes – together with theft – could be related to individuals using e-scooters in 2021.
Data has proven that of these offences reported to Essex Police, 39 robberies and 91 thefts could be related to individuals using e-scooters
At least 18 offences described as violence in opposition to the individual could be related to e-scooters.
Read more: Latest information about crime
Responding to an FOI over linkage between e-scooters and crimes Essex Police and it can’t differentiate between a motorcar or scooter for offences.
However Essex Police says it will probably verify 167 related hits within the first 10 months of 2021 when the place the phrase “e-scooter” OR “e-scooter” OR “e scooter” OR “electric scooter” OR “spin scooter” are used to search its crime database.
Of the entire 167 incidents, 10 resulted in both prices, summonses or a postal requisition – a authorized doc notifying somebody {that a} resolution has been made to prosecute somebody at courtroom.
Five have been for theft, one for theft, one for violence in opposition to the individual, two for possession for weapons offences and one for crimes in opposition to society.
The figures are small as compared with the approximate 150,000 offences reported to Essex Police in 2021.
But it comes on the again of a dramatic rise within the numbers of e-scooter gross sales though solely these a part of the county’s trial could be legally ridden on roads.
Spin rental e-scooter trials in 5 cities and cities in Essex are being prolonged for one more year to enable for more proof to be gathered as a part of planning for his or her function in the way forward for sustainable transport.
On the again drop of the unlawful riders the variety of e-scooters seized by Essex Police has risen tenfold within the house of a year and there days are “limited”, the county’s crime commissioner has stated.
Essex’s Police, Fire and Crime Commissioner, Roger Hirst, made the comment as figures present that in 2020 simply 38 e-scooters have been seized by Essex Police.

However, in 2021 a complete of 317 e-scooters have been seized.
Mr Hirst stated: “My private view is I do not suppose they are going to be a factor for very lengthy as a result of they’re clearly not secure.”
A DfT spokesperson stated: “Safety will always be our top priority and the trials currently taking place in 31 regions across England are allowing us to better understand the benefits of e-scooters and their impact on public space.
“While feedback from the trials has generally been positive, we know there have been a minority of instances where e-scooters have been misused. We’re clear to local authorities and operators taking part in legal trials of rental e-scooters that they should be proactive in dealing with instances of e-scooter misuse.”
